The bear’s den may be a ground nest, a hollow tree, a rock crevice or other natural cavity. The den is prepared in October, and the bear sleeps inside it from November to March. Where winters are especially harsh, the bears may enter their dens as early as October and emerge as lat...
Black bears are omnivores (杂食动物), meaning they eat both meat and plants. This has a problem for black bears living in the parts of North America where winter lasts for many months. The plants die off during the winter, and there isn’t enough to eat. ...

Tracks and Signs of Black Bears (Ursus americanus)This black bear scat shows the seeds of a coffee berry plant. Bears have a mixed diet that includes about 80 percent vegetable matter, some insects, and meat. Their scats are accordingly varied in appearance, contents, and size. The scat ...
